The Power of Faith

Embarking on a journey of Umrah is a deeply spiritual experience that calls upon the power of faith. As I reflect on the significance of this sacred pilgrimage, I am reminded of the words of Prophet Muhammad (peace be upon him): “The believer’s shade on the Day of Resurrection will be his charity.” This quote serves as a powerful reminder of the importance of acts of kindness and generosity in our daily lives.

Another inspiring quote that resonates with me is by Rumi, the renowned Persian poet. He once said, “There are a thousand ways to kneel and kiss the ground; there are a thousand ways to go home again.” These words speak to the diverse ways in which we can express our devotion to the divine, highlighting the beauty of individual spiritual journeys.

The Blessings of Gratitude

In the hustle and bustle of our modern world, it is easy to lose sight of the blessings that surround us. However, the journey of Umrah serves as a powerful reminder to cultivate gratitude in our hearts. As I prepare for my pilgrimage, I am inspired by the words of Imam Ali (may Allah be pleased with him): “Gratitude turns what we have into enough.” These words encourage me to reflect on the abundance of blessings in my life and to express heartfelt thanks for them.

Another quote that resonates with me is by the poet Sylvia Plath. She once said, “I took a deep breath and listened to the old bray of my heart: I am, I am, I am.” These words serve as a poignant reminder to take a moment to appreciate the miracle of life and to be grateful for the gift of each breath.

The Journey of Self-Discovery

The journey of Umrah is not just a physical pilgrimage; it is also a journey of self-discovery and inner reflection. As I embark on this sacred voyage, I am reminded of the words of the Sufi mystic Ibn Arabi: “The real voyage of discovery consists not in seeking new landscapes, but in having new eyes.” These words inspire me to look within and to explore the depths of my own soul in search of spiritual awakening.

Additionally, the words of the poet Rainer Maria Rilke resonate with me deeply: “Perhaps all the dragons in our lives are princesses who are waiting to see us act, just once, with beauty and courage.” These words serve as a powerful reminder to confront our inner fears and insecurities with grace and strength, paving the way for personal growth and transformation.

The Importance of Community

As I prepare for my journey of Umrah, I am reminded of the importance of community and connection in the spiritual path. The words of the Prophet Muhammad (peace be upon him) echo in my heart: “A believer to another believer is like a building whose different parts enforce each other.” This quote highlights the significance of mutual support and camaraderie in our spiritual journeys, emphasizing the strength that comes from unity.


Another quote that resonates with me is by the author Elizabeth Gilbert. She once said, “We don’t realize that, somewhere within us all, there does exist a supreme self who is eternally at peace.” These words serve as a reminder of the interconnectedness of all beings and the intrinsic unity that binds us together as a global community.

The Call of Compassion

As I prepare to embark on my journey of Umrah, I am reminded of the call to embody compassion and kindness in all aspects of life. The words of the Sufi poet Hafiz resonate with me deeply: “Even after all this time, the sun never says to the earth, ‘You owe me.’ Look what happens with a love like that. It lights the whole sky.” This quote serves as a powerful reminder of the transformative power of unconditional love and compassion.

Additionally, the words of Mother Teresa inspire me to cultivate a spirit of service and generosity. She once said, “Not all of us can do great things. But we can do small things with great love.” These words remind me that even the smallest acts of kindness can have a profound impact on the world around us.

The Path of Wisdom

As I prepare for my journey of Umrah, I am inspired by the wisdom of ancient sages and spiritual luminaries. The words of the poet Rumi resonate with me deeply: “Yesterday I was clever, so I wanted to change the world. Today I am wise, so I am changing myself.” These words serve as a powerful reminder of the importance of inner transformation and personal growth on the path to spiritual enlightenment.

Another quote that speaks to me is by the philosopher Lao Tzu. He once said, “Knowing others is intelligence; knowing yourself is true wisdom. Mastering others is strength; mastering yourself is true power.” These words highlight the significance of self-awareness and self-mastery in the pursuit of spiritual awakening.

The Light of Hope

In the midst of life’s challenges and uncertainties, the journey of Umrah serves as a beacon of hope and inspiration. As I prepare to embark on this sacred pilgrimage, the words of the poet Emily Dickinson resonate with me: “Hope is the thing with feathers that perches in the soul and sings the tune without the words and never stops at all.” These words serve as a reminder of the enduring power of hope to guide us through the darkest of times.

Additionally, the words of the renowned activist Mahatma Gandhi inspire me to hold onto hope in the face of adversity. He once said, “You must not lose faith in humanity. Humanity is like an ocean; if a few drops of the ocean are dirty, the ocean does not become dirty.” These words remind me of the resilience of the human spirit and the capacity for positive change in the world.
